A former parking meter attendant accused of stealing $120,000 - in cents - has pleaded guilty to embezzlement and has promised to pay most of it back.

Vincent J. Howard agreed in court Tuesday to repay $70,000 within 30 days and $30,000 more over the two years that he will be on probation.

Macomb County Circuit Judge Richard Caretti also ordered the 50-year-old Howard to spend six months on an electronic tether.

Howard, who worked for the Detroit suburb of Mount Clemens for 23 years, was arrested last year after police raided his home and found thousands of dollars in coins. They also found $500 in Howard's car and $2,000 in a city-owned car he used on his rounds.

"He said he took $500 every two weeks for 10 years to pay bills," said county Assistant Prosecutor Steve Steinhardt. "But I think he used the money to more than supplement his income."

Howard now works as a $9-an-hour laborer for a fence company.
